1. Security and Access Control

One of the most critical aspects of smart home automation is security. Devices like Yale locks with Bluetooth and Z-Wave integration offer key-free entry, but they come with their own set of challenges. For instance, integrating these locks with other smart home systems can sometimes lead to compatibility issues. It’s essential to ensure that all devices are on the same network and that firmware updates are regularly applied to maintain security.

2. HVAC Automation

Automating heating and cooling systems can significantly enhance comfort and energy efficiency. However, issues like the Nest thermostat not allowing target temperature adjustments can be perplexing. This often stems from misconfigurations in the binding settings or missing semantic properties. Ensuring that all channels are correctly set up and that the thermostat is properly integrated with the smart home ecosystem is crucial.

3. Integration with Security Systems

Integrating smart home devices with existing security systems, such as Frontpoint or Qolsys IQ panels, can be a daunting task. Compatibility issues often arise due to differing communication protocols like Z-Wave, Zigbee, or proprietary systems. Researching device compatibility and using intermediary hubs or translators can help bridge these gaps. For example, the RE224DT DSC-to-2GIG translator can facilitate communication between legacy systems and modern smart home platforms.

4. Energy Efficiency and Lighting

Smart lighting solutions, especially those using LED bulbs, are a cornerstone of energy-efficient homes. However, selecting the right dimmer switch can be tricky. Devices like the Fibaro dimmer are popular, but alternatives like the Leviton D26HD WiFi dimmer also offer robust performance. Ensuring that these devices are compatible with your smart home platform and that they receive regular firmware updates is essential for optimal performance.

5. Troubleshooting and Maintenance

Like any technology, smart home devices require regular maintenance. Issues such as battery drain in keypads or unexpected device behavior can often be resolved by resetting the device or checking for firmware updates. Additionally, monitoring system logs can provide valuable insights into recurring issues, such as DNS resolution problems or health check timeouts in Docker containers.
